WebAug 9, 2024 · At a portland cement manufacturing plant, fly ash may be used in the process, principally, at three points. It can be mixed with the finished cement, interground with the cement clinker, or serve as a component in the cement raw batch. WebThe direct CO 2 intensity of cement production increased about 1.5% per year during 2015-2024. In contrast, 3% annual declines to 2030 are necessary to get on track with the Net Zero Emissions by 2050 Scenario.
